View Top Employees for reson
img Website res-on.co.za
img Industry Internet
img Location Nelson Mandela Bay, Eastern Cape, South Africa
Founded 2017
img Website
img Industry Internet
img Employees 5
img Founded 2017
img LinkedIn

Top Reson Employees